About

Meili Ma is a scholar working on Oncology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Cancer Research. According to data from OpenAlex, Meili Ma has authored 25 papers receiving a total of 293 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Oncology, 9 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 7 papers in Cancer Research. Recurrent topics in Meili Ma's work include Lung Cancer Treatments and Mutations (7 papers), Pancreatitis Pathology and Treatment (6 papers) and Lung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ment (5 papers). Meili Ma is often cited by papers focused on Lung Cancer Treatments and Mutations (7 papers), Pancreatitis Pathology and Treatment (6 papers) and Lung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ment (5 papers). Meili Ma coll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Singapore. Meili Ma's co-authors include Baohui Han, Jialin Qian, Chunlei Shi, Xiping Zhang, Jun Pei, Xueyan Zhang, Yanwei Zhang, Rong Li, Jing Wu and Yiyi Song and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and Frontiers in Immunology.
